CPU: AMD Athlon 64 3500+, 512K, L2 Cache, Socket 939 Windows Compatible 64-bit Processor - Retail
MOTHERBOARD: MSI "K8T NEO2-FIR" VIA K8T800 Pro Chipset Motherboard for AMD Socket 939 CPU -RETAIL
MEMORY: Kingston 184 Pin 512MB DDR PC-3200 - Retail x 2 (1 gig)
VIDEO: Sapphire ATI Radeon X800 SE Video Card, 256MB DDR, 256-Bit, DVI/TV-Out, 8X AGP, Model "102-A26126-00-AT" -OEM
HARD DRIVE: Western Digital 120GB 7200RPM SATA Hard Drive, Model WD1200JD, OEM Drive Only
SOUND: Creative Labs Sound Blaster Audigy2 ZS PCI Sound Card, Model "SB0350" OEM
DVD: NEC 16X Double Layer DVD±RW Drive, Black, Model ND-3500A BK W/SW, OEM with software
CASE: Aspire X-Dreamer II(Black) ATX Mid-Tower Case with 350W Power Supply, With Window, Model "ATXB4KLW-BK/350"
Total cost is: $1,158.00 from newegg.com (without shipping)
I've compiled the above setup from reading articles for the last couple of months on Anantech, Tomshardware and Sharkyextreme. However this is a big purchase for me, so I want to get it right the first time. If there is any change you would recommend, and think its justified please tell me.
I want to use the machine for gaming (HL2), web development and mp3/dvd authoring. I guess I would classify it as a middle of the road rig.
